SPECIFICATION

  • Media Type : Business Card
  • Scanner Type : Business Card
  • Brand : CardScan
  • Resolution : 600
  • Sheet Size : Executive
  • Optical Sensor Technology : CIS
  • Minimum System Requirements : Windows 7
  • Package Dimensions : 13.3 x 10.2 x 5.2 inches
  • Item Weight : 5.35 pounds
  • Item model number : CSA03950

HOW TO USE

  • Establish Connection: Connect the scanner to your computer by utilizing the included USB cable.
  • Software Installation: Install the CardScan software as instructed on your computer.
  • Power On: Power up the scanner.
  • Business Card Placement: Insert the business card you wish to scan into the scanner’s feeder.
  • Software Launch: Open the CardScan software on your computer.
  • Initiate Scanning: Commence the scanning process by clicking the “Scan” button within the software.
  • Data Preservation: The scanned data is captured and preserved within your CardScan database.
  • Review and Organization: Inspect and adjust the scanned business card data within the software as necessary.
  • Synchronization: Synchronize your scanned business card data with other contact management systems.
  • Storage and Export: Safeguard and export the scanned business card data for utilization in other applications.

TROUBLESHOOTING

  • Scanner Not Recognized: Ensure the USB cable is correctly connected, and drivers are installed.
  • Scan Quality Issues: Address scan quality problems by cleaning the scanner feeder and glass and checking calibration and resolution settings.
  • Software Errors: Resolve software issues by updating or reinstalling the CardScan software.
  • Business Card Jams: If a business card becomes jammed, power off the scanner and cautiously remove the jammed card.
  • Connection Challenges: Verify that the USB port and cable are functioning correctly for a stable connection.
